8GSC-9, Seoul 18 WiBro : Wireless Broadband Internet Service Establishment of WiBro project group(PG05) (June 2003) Total 48 member companies including 6 foreign companies (Datacraft Korea, Motorola Korea, Qualcomm Korea, Arraycomm, Intel Korea, Nortel Networks Korea) Service carriers : 7 Manufacturers : 27 Academies : 8 Research org. etc : 6 Establishment of 4 Working Groups (Radio Access, Service & Network, IPR, International collaboration, Adhoc Group) (September 2003) Key Standardization Items – WiBro (1/2)
9GSC-9, Seoul 18 Approval of Major system parameters of WiBro (January 2004) Adoption of WiBro Draft Standard (March 2004) Approval of WiBro Standard at Technical Assembly (June 2004) Decision Major system parameters TDD, OFDMA, Channel BW=10MHz Radio access requirements Frequency Reuse Factor=1. Mobility-60Km/h, Service Coverage 1Km Frequency Efficiency (Maximum DL/UL=6/2, Average DL/UL=2/1) Hand-off (between cells, Sectors & Frequencies >150ms) Throughput per an user (Max DL/UL=3/1Mbps, Min DL/UL=512/128kbps) Key Standardization Items – WiBro (2/2)

12GSC-9, Seoul Brief History In April 1988, Communication Technology Promotion Council examined the feasibilities to establish a Civilian Standardization Organization - to cope with global trends, privatization, competition, deregulation - to cope with the requests for the opening of Korea telecom market - to promote civilian standardization activities in Korea December 1988, Establishment of TTA - by the Article 32, Civil Law August 1992, Extension of TTA - Accredited as Standardization Organization by MIC - by the Article 30, The Framework Act on Telecommunications December 2001, Launching the Testing and Certification Services - Network, Software, Digital Broadcasting and Mobile Areas - TTA moved to new Office in Bundang, Kyunggi province 2
13GSC-9, Seoul Major Activities Establishment of Standards in the field of Info-Communications Dissemination of the Standards information - Standards Deliverables, Research Reports, Seminars and Training, and Info-Comm Dictionary, etc. International Standardization Activities - Recognized as ITU-T Rec. referencing organization (Jul. 2001) - CJK IT Standards Meeting among CCSA, ARIB, TTC, TTA - Global Standards Collaboration (GSC/RAST) - 3rd Generation Mobile Partnership Projects (3GPP, 3GPP2) - Bilateral Standardization Cooperation with SDOs (ACIF, ETSI, ITU-AJ TTC, ARIB, T1, TSACC) IT Testing and Certification Services in the areas of Network Equipment, Software Products, Digital Broadcasting Equipments and Mobile Communication Terminals 3
